Farecast predicts when plane tickets will be cheapest

John Batelle has a great writeup of a new service called "Farecast" that uses historical pricing data from the airlines to predict what the best time will be to buy a given plane-ticket. The service is in private Beta right now and only works for Seattle and Boston, but they're promising a full launch later this year with all cities covered.
